Homemade Tater Tots Recipe

This homemade tater tots recipe makes all store bought tots seem sad. Perfectly seasoned shredded potatoes get formed into barrels and fried to perfection for a side dish everyone in the family will love for breakfast, lunch, or dinner!

Ingredients

  • 2 lbs russet potatoes 4-5 medium, peeled
  • 2 tablespoons flour
  • ½ teaspoon garlic powder
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¼ teaspoon onion powder
  • ¼ teaspoon paprika
  • Oil for frying
  • Fresh minced parsley for garnish optional

Instructions

  • Place the peeled potatoes in a large pot and cover with water. Bring the water to a boil and cook for 8-10 minutes, or until the potatoes are partially cooked

  • Drain the potatoes then allow to cool until easily handled.
  • Shred the potatoes using a food processor with a shredding attachment or a box grater, then add to a larger bowl along with the flour, garlic powder, salt, onion powder, and paprika and mix well

  • Squeeze the potato into small cylinders to form the tots, place on a piece of parchment paper until ready to cook
  • Heat a heavy bottom pot with oil to 350F. Add the tots and fry in batches of 5-8 pieces, depending on the size of the pot. Cook for 5 minutes or until golden brown then remove and place on a paper towel lined plate. Repeat until all tots have been cooked.

  • Serve immediately with a sprinkle of parsley if desired.

Notes

  • Make sure not to overcrowd the skillet when you are frying the tots. The tots won't get as crispy and may sort of stick together if they are touching.
  • Use these in any casserole you would use tater tots in!
  • Serve them loaded with chili and cheese on top for a hearty meal that's a real treat.
